The Rapid City Police Department is one of the most progressive law enforcement agencies in the region and the only internationally accredited police department in South Dakota. The RCPD is comprised of three divisions with diverse operations staffed by nearly 165 uniformed and non-uniformed staff. These operations include field services, criminal investigations and support services. RCPD offers a variety of services, and are especially proud of the proactive programs to keep our community safe, such as the School Liaison Program and our civilian traffic investigators. We also see ourselves as a leader in quality training throughout the region, with outstanding recruit training and Police Training Officer programs to cultivate committed, courteous officers for our department.

The mission of the Rapid City Police Department is community first, service above self, integrity-driven: one interaction at a time. As a Police Officer, you'll provide protection of life and property within the municipal boundaries of the City of Rapid City.
The Rapid City Police Department is seeking CERTIFIED POLICE OFFICERS to join our team. If you hold a current law enforcement certification (from South Dakota or another state) with prior law enforcement experience, we'd like to talk with you!
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
Protects life by:

  • Responding to calls for service and emergency assistance; rendering aid to the physically injured, handicapped and others requiring assistance, including but not limited to victims of accidents, criminal incidents, natural disasters or other incidents; investigating safety hazards and taking action to correct potential problem areas, including road hazards, defects and environmental hazards.
Preserves peace by:
  • Responding to calls for assistance involving altercations between people, including but not limited to domestic disturbances, fighting and neighborhood disputes, performing crowd and traffic control; enforcing state and city ordinances relating to keeping the peace; providing motorized, foot and bicycle patrol to residential and business areas to maintain community relations; practice problem solving techniques in support of the department's demographic policing, community policing and problem solving strategies.
  • Investigates violations of state laws/city ordinances and arrests violators using degree of force necessary with state law and department policy. Enforces traffic laws to curtail violations.
  • Secures crime scenes to identify and collect any physical evidence present, and obtains descriptions of suspects/vehicles involved in crimes or criminal activity.
  • Prepares incident/accident reports, affidavits, citations, legal documents, memorandums, other job-related documents and prepares for court testimony.
  • Operates police vehicles in routine and emergency situations.
  • Participates in job-related training and courses to maintain skills, knowledge and abilities necessary to perform duties.
